The catholic Bishops in the English speaking regions of Cameroon held a meeting in Fiango Kumba, yesterday 24th August, where they call on the public(southern cameroon activists against school resumption) to decease from violence and threats related to school resumption, and let children go back to school. They however say that this decision does not rule out the anglophone problem. They are still advocating for the release of those affected and inclusive dialogue, but they welcome the idea of school resumption this September. Read full statement below:
